but, still, when push came to shove, trump could not kill obamacare. he managed to get the bill -- a bill through the house. but when that bill got to senate, even republican senators thought it was too extreme, so they wrote their own bill instead, and even then the republican controlled senate could not pass that bill, which, again, was written by republican senators. you probably remember how that all went down because it was very, very dramatic. it was the end of july, 2017. republican senator susan collins and lisa murkowski had crossed the aisle to vote with democrats against the bill. republicans only needed one final vote to get a 50-50 tie and vice president kamala harris mike pence was eagerly standing by to cast that tie breaking vote to kill the affordable care act, only to have senator john mccain stun both republicans and the nation with his vote at 1:30 in the morning. moderate republicans joining with democrats in the senate saved the health care of what at the time was an estimated 15 million americans, a number that has, by the way, r
